In recent news, the Nasdaq and Bitcoin (BTC) experienced a notable decline that appears to coincide with a significant rise in Japanese government bond yields and an increase in the value of the safe-haven Japanese yen (JPY). This pattern reminds many of Market movements observed in early August.
As the yen strengthens, risk appetite seems to diminish on Wall Street, affecting both stocks and cryptocurrencies. Traditionally, a lower-yielding yen has supported global asset prices, and its current rise may indeed contribute to a cautious sentiment among investors. Recently, speculators have held record-long positions in the yen, which could lead to disappointment and a potential bearish reversal. If this happens, we might see some relief for risk assets like the Nasdaq and Bitcoin.
Market analysts from Morgan Stanley noted their caution regarding further yen strength due to this overstretched positioning. They emphasize that strong domestic buying habits among Japanese investors might slow down the yen’s appreciation. Such patterns mirror last August’s Market behavior when the yen appreciated significantly, leading to a sell-off in equities.
Looking at current prices, Bitcoin is trading near $80,300, reflecting a decline of nearly 5% for the month. Meanwhile, the USD/JPY exchange rate is at 147.23, following a five-month low of 145.53.
Temporary Respite Ahead?
Although the current speculative positions and institutional flows suggest a possible short-term recovery for risk assets, the overall bullish sentiment for the yen remains substantial due to the narrowing yield differential between U.S. and Japanese bonds. Investors should stay alert for any sudden price swings in the yen and across broader financial markets.
As history has shown, if the yen’s rise stalls, we might see a renewed surge in Market optimism for the Nasdaq and Bitcoin.
